How Much Does Total hip replacement for developmental dysplasia of the hip Cost in Spain?

Total hip replacement for developmental dysplasia of the hip in Spain typically costs from $12,000 to $25,000. The final price depends on surgical complexity, the need for bone grafting, and the chosen city. Patients save around 74% compared to the US, where the average cost is $70,000. Standard Spanish packages usually include high-quality implants, specialized surgical fees, a 5-day private hospital stay, and initial physiotherapy.

  • Robotic-assisted surgery: Typically adds a 20-30% premium over traditional manual techniques for higher precision.
  • Advanced navigation systems: Costs increase when using specialized technology like Brainlab for complex joint placement.
  • Regional variations: Major medical hubs include Barcelona and Madrid, with secondary centers located in Marbella.
  • Complex anatomy needs: Procedures involving femoral shortening osteotomies or custom-made implants often reach the higher price range.
